Power output module POM4220 Lowend- 16 outputs for connecting resistive loads.
- A current of up to 6.3 A can be used per output.
- The two phases and neutral conductor are connected via a 3-pin connector (mating connectors are included in the scope of delivery).
- The heat emitters are connected via two 8-pin connectors (mating connectors are included in the scope of delivery).
- One fuse per output for supply circuit.
- Module simply slides into the rack.
- Heat dissipation via an optional fan module at the top of the rack (for 4 POM4220).
- Attachment is with one screw at the bottom and another one at the top.
- Three diagnostics LEDs for displaying module faults.
- Sixteen diagnostics LEDs for displaying errors at the outputs.
